Patches
Sagaras 2016 Patch (For English/French/German Release)
This patch lets you install the game on Windows 10 (including 64-bit versions). It also includes custom resolution and widescreen hacks, as well as official 1.1 patch.
It requires the original CD or DVD (English, French and German version supported).
Start the game by launching TPM_FIX.exe
after the installation.

Installing on 64-bit versions of Windows
- The 16-bit installer can't be used on 64-bit versions of Windows so the game must be installed using a fan made installer or installing the game manually.
Alternative installer for x86/x64[1] |
---|
German website with the installers: website An alternative Inno Setup installer can be downloaded from mediafire for CD-Version and DVD-Collection Version. The alternative installer includes dgvoodoo 2.5, widescreen resoluten fix, new launcher with extended game hardware configuration, batch startfix to play the game with single core on multi core systems, patch v1.1 integrated, AND FFmpeg with Batchfile to extracting video and Scumm Revisited v2.0.12.46 for convert iMUSE audio files of the game. It's the ultimative installer for english, german und french version for this game. |
